Output e36126789680b51a91ca308fb2a771d9b31a0d521b641a732dfdf1521c9a68ce:12

value
57794083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 211b37a8c442570d2729c93f330c1eb98cdd680e OP_EQUAL
address
34i4pyRNMcVoQoiY42Cs8U92d8Cr1PvjvM
transaction
e36126789680b51a91ca308fb2a771d9b31a0d521b641a732dfdf1521c9a68ce
spent
true